Angélique SAUVAGEAU was born 1 October 1804 in Grondines, Lower Canada

Angélique SAUVAGEAU was the child of François SAUVAGEAU   and   Marguerite RIVARD dite LORANGER and the grandchild of: (paternal)  Joseph-Marie SAUVAGEAU and Josette PAQUIN (maternal)  Charles-Francois RIVARD dit LORANGER and Reine-Renee BIGUET dite NOBERT

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Angélique  married  François-Xavier DEHOU dit DEVILLERS 11 November 1828 in Grondines, Lower Canada .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
François-Xavier DEHOU dit DEVILLERS  was born 9 March 1805 in Sainte-Foy, Québec, Québec, Canada (Notre-Dame-de-Foy).  François-Xavier was the child of Pierre DEHOU dit DEVILLERS and Marie-Flavie CHAVIGNY dite LACHEVROTIÈRE.

Angélique SAUVAGEAU died 25 May 1837 in Grondines, Lower Canada .

Did You Know? Québec Généalogie - Over time, Québec has gone through a series of name changes
From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
